Australias Raman spectroscopy market is growing due to increasing applications in pharmaceuticals, material science, and environmental monitoring. The adoption of AI-powered spectroscopy solutions is enhancing real-time chemical analysis, quality control in manufacturing, and medical diagnostics. The push for advanced research in nanotechnology and drug discovery is further accelerating the demand for Raman spectrometers.
The Raman spectroscopy market in Australia is growing due to increasing demand for precise chemical analysis in pharmaceuticals, environmental monitoring, and materials science. Rising adoption of portable Raman spectrometers and real-time data analysis is driving market growth. Enhanced focus on improving spectral resolution and sensitivity is further supporting market expansion.
The Raman spectroscopy market in Australia faces challenges from high equipment costs and limited technical expertise in analyzing Raman data. Sensitivity issues with low-concentration samples further restrict market adoption.
The Australia Raman Spectroscopy Market offers growth opportunities due to increasing demand for material identification in pharmaceuticals and research. Investment opportunities include developing AI-based Raman spectroscopy platforms, improving data accuracy, and expanding into healthcare and chemical industries.
Raman spectroscopy systems used in medical and industrial applications are regulated under the Therapeutic Goods Act 1989 and the Environmental Protection Act 1994. The government requires that Raman spectroscopy systems used in healthcare comply with safety and accuracy guidelines set by the Therapeutic Goods Administration (TGA). Environmental sensing systems must meet data accuracy and calibration standards.
